IEP at Ohio University is seeking a Study Abroad Marketing and Outreach intern starting August 12, 2013. The details follow. Applications will be accepted through May 10, 2013.

ABOUT IEP

--------------

IEP - International Education Programs at Ohio University - offers affordable and immersive study, volunteer, service-learning and internship programs in over 20 countries throughout Latin America, Europe, Africa, Asia and Oceania. IEP academic and internship programs offer experiences for a wide variety of majors and include direct-enrollment programs at large prestigious universities abroad, center-based culture and development studies, and customized internships.

IEP is based at Ohio University (OHIO). OHIO is a four-year public, comprehensive university located in beautiful Athens, Ohio. IEP at OHIO works collaboratively with the Ohio University Office of Education Abroad.

INTERNSHIP

---------------

This placement is geared towards students interested in pursuing a career in international education, with a focus on education abroad. Interns will be working in a small office assisting with the creation and execution of a marketing and outreach plan for IEP at Ohio University. At the conclusion of this placement, interns will have gained solid skills expected of an entry-level education abroad professional and will take away a portfolio of marketing and outreach ideas. This position is based at Ohio University in Athens, OH. Applicants should take into consideration relocation time and expenses when applying (if applicable).

The internship runs from August 12, 2013 through November 30, 2013 with an option to renew for January 13, 2014 through April 30, 2014.



EXPECTATIONS:

Title: Marketing & Outreach Intern

Marketing:

- Maintain website

- Manage social media outlets (Facebook, Twitter, etc.)

- Create printed marketing materials for campus promotions

- Identify marketing outlets to promote study abroad to OHIO students

- Work to increase study abroad awareness on OHIO regional campuses

- Work with IEP study abroad advisor to develop new marketing initiatives to increase study abroad awareness and participation on campus



Outreach:

- Conduct class visits/organize program alumni to conduct class visits

- Organize and oversee Student Ambassador Program (alumni outreach)

- Schedule and staff various outreach events on campus (including annual Study Abroad Fair)

- Work with IEP Study Abroad Advisor to develop new events and tabling opportunities on campus



Advising:

- Be knowledgeable about all IEP programs and OU programs in order to answer student questions

- Advise students at events on IEP programs



-Other duties or projects as assigned



ELIGIBILITY:

----------------

Interest in international education as a future career path

Previous international experience (study, intern, significant travel, residence, etc.)

Engaged in student development

Strong verbal and written communication skills

Ability to talk with large groups of people in diverse environments

Excellent organizational skills

Initiative in starting new projects and making independent decisions

Ability to work with diverse personalities

Proficient on the computer (MAC & PC) or quick learner with technology

Professional and friendly

Available no less than 20 hours/week

Must have authorization to work in the U.S.
